Inclinometer, tilt angle detector "CA-910", tilt sensor, suitable for construction machinery.

The "CA-910" is a robust servo-type tilt angle detector that uses Makome Laboratory's original high-precision magnetic sensor. It is ideal for construction machinery!

The tilt angle detector is detected with high precision by our proprietary magnetic sensor. Originally developed for construction machinery (impact pile drivers), it is robust. The pendulum is supported by bearings, providing a design that is resistant to shock and vibration. By controlling the position of the pendulum with a servo circuit, stable output can be achieved. Vertical output (detection) Please feel free to consult us about waterproofing measures.

Tilt meter, tilt angle detector "CM-961A": Makome Research Institute, MEMS

The inclinometer "CM-961A" is an inclination sensor that uses a MEMS accelerometer. It features a metal case, making it durable, and has a protection structure of IP-67.

The tilt meter detects using a MEMS accelerometer (MEMS: Micro-Electro-Mechanical Systems). Additionally, it is designed with a metal case to provide shock resistance and vibration resistance. It is compact (compared to our products). The output is available in two types: voltage output type 1-5V and current output type 4-20mA. As an additional feature, it includes a switch function. You can obtain transistor output at any desired tilt position (specified at the time of order). It has a function to correct installation errors, allowing for correction to 0° within a range of ±1°. There is a YouTube video available. Within the CM-900 series, there is also the "CM-936," which outputs a rotation angle of 360° linearly. It outputs the rotation angle from 0 to 360° as DC voltage 1-5V or current 4-20mA (specified at the time of order).
